The GIS Programmer position designs, creates, modifies, or manages GIS software applications.
Time is divided between the maintenance of current applications and the design of new applications. The GIS Programmer may also be called upon to do mapping.
Provides internet and web based support, as well as technical support to other GIS professionals.
Develops spatial and non-spatial databases.
Position is responsible for effectively integrating GIS with other applications and enterprise database systems.
Minimum Education Level & Type: Bachelor's Degree
Minimum Experience Qualifications: At least 3 years of experience in programming in Visual Basic, C++ or vendor specific GIS software programming languages
